Lead safety orientations for new employees and subcontractors
Assist in maintaining up-to-date employee training and certification records
Verify proper use of PPE, fall protection, ladders, scaffolds, and confined space procedures
Liaise with project managers, foremen, and office staff to coordinate safety initiatives
Conduct routine site inspections at multiple job locations to identify and correct unsafe behaviors or conditions
Promote engagement and accountability in all safety efforts
Ensure adherence to OSHA, NFPA, and Ackerman Plumbing safety policies
Identify opportunities for hazard reduction and process improvement
Assist with root cause analysis and corrective action plans
Conduct regular toolbox talks and safety refreshers on topics including hazard communication, lockout/tagout, and equipment operation
Communicate safety expectations and updates clearly across all field teams
Respond promptly to incidents, near misses, and unsafe conditions
Support the Safety Manager in implementing company-wide safety initiatives
Partner with superintendents and field leaders to implement and enforce safety standards
Maintain accurate safety documentation and submit reports to management as required

Strong working knowledge of OSHA regulations and safety best practices
Valid driver’s license and reliable transportation
Excellent communication and interpersonal skills
Ability to travel to multiple job sites across Florida
Proficient in Microsoft Office and basic reporting tools
OSHA 510/500 or CHST certification (preferred)
OSHA 30-Hour Construction Certification (required)
High school diploma or equivalent required; associate’s or bachelor’s degree in occupational safety, Construction Management, or related field preferred
Ability to lead safety meetings and engage field personnel
2–4 years of experience in construction safety supervision, preferably in commercial or industrial environments
First Aid/CPR certification (required)
